Comparing Performance: Linux Dedicated vs Linux Windows Shared
When it comes to hosting your website or application, performance is a critical factor that can significantly impact user experience, SEO rankings, and overall business success. Choosing between Linux dedicated hosting and Linux Windows shared hosting involves evaluating various performance metrics to determine which option best meets your specific needs. This article delves into the performance aspects of both hosting types to help you make an informed decision.
Understanding Linux Dedicated Hosting
Linux Dedicated Hosting involves leasing an entire physical server exclusively for your website or application. This type of hosting provides:
- Dedicated Resources: Resources such as CPU, RAM, disk space, and bandwidth are dedicated solely to your website or application. This ensures consistent performance without being affected by other users.
- High Performance: With dedicated resources, Best Linux dedicated hosting typically offers higher performance levels, faster loading times, and better responsiveness, especially for resource-intensive applications or websites with high traffic volumes.
- Customization and Control: You have full control over server configurations, software installations, and security settings. This level of customization allows you to optimize server performance based on your specific requirements.
- Scalability: Linux dedicated servers can be scaled vertically (upgrading resources like RAM or CPU) or horizontally (adding more servers) to accommodate growth and increased traffic demands.
- Security: Enhanced security measures can be implemented, including custom firewalls, intrusion detection systems, and regular security updates, ensuring robust protection against potential threats.
Exploring Linux Windows Shared Hosting
Linux Windows Shared Hosting involves multiple websites sharing resources on a single server running Linux and Windows operating systems. This type of hosting offers:
- Cost-Effectiveness: Shared hosting is generally more affordable than dedicated hosting, as the costs of server maintenance and resources are distributed among multiple users sharing the same server.
- Ease of Use: Shared hosting providers manage server maintenance, software updates, and security configurations, making it an ideal choice for beginners or users who prefer a hands-off approach to server management.
- Shared Resources: Resources such as CPU, RAM, and disk space are shared among multiple websites hosted on the same server. This can lead to performance variations depending on the usage and traffic of other websites sharing the server.
- Limited Customization: While shared hosting plans may offer some level of customization, such as choosing software versions or adding certain applications, you have limited control over server configurations compared to dedicated hosting.
- Scalability Challenges: Shared hosting may have limitations in scaling resources, as the server’s capacity is shared among multiple users. High traffic spikes or resource-intensive applications may impact performance.
- Security Concerns: Shared hosting environments are susceptible to security risks from neighboring websites. While providers implement security measures, the actions of other users on the server can affect overall security.
Performance Metrics Comparison
1. Server Response Time:
- Linux Dedicated Hosting: With dedicated resources, server response times are generally faster and more consistent. This is crucial for reducing latency and ensuring quick loading times, which contributes to a positive user experience and SEO benefits.
- Linux Windows Shared Hosting: Server response times in shared hosting environments can vary depending on server load and the activities of other websites sharing resources. High traffic or resource-intensive websites on the same server can potentially slow down response times for all users.
2. Website Loading Speed:
- Linux Dedicated Hosting: Dedicated resources allow for optimized server configurations and faster website loading speeds. This is advantageous for websites that require quick content delivery, such as e-commerce platforms or media-rich sites.
- Linux Windows Shared Hosting: Loading speeds may be affected by shared resources and server congestion. While caching mechanisms and content delivery networks (CDNs) can help mitigate this, shared hosting may not offer the same level of speed optimization as dedicated hosting.
3. Scalability and Resource Allocation:
- Linux Dedicated Hosting: Scalability is flexible with dedicated servers, allowing you to upgrade resources as your website grows. This ensures that your website can handle increasing traffic and resource demands without compromising performance.
- Linux Windows Shared Hosting: Resource allocation is shared among multiple users, which can limit scalability options. High traffic spikes or sudden resource demands may lead to performance issues if the server’s capacity is exceeded.
4. Uptime and Reliability:
- Linux Dedicated Hosting: Providers typically guarantee high uptime percentages (e.g., 99.9% or higher), ensuring minimal downtime and reliable access to your website. Dedicated servers offer stability and resilience against server failures or issues affecting shared environments.
- Linux Windows Shared Hosting: Uptime may be affected by server maintenance, hardware failures, or issues arising from other websites on the same server. While reputable providers strive for high uptime, shared hosting environments inherently carry a higher risk of downtime.
5. Security and Data Protection:
- Linux Dedicated Hosting: Enhanced security measures, such as dedicated firewalls, regular security audits, and proactive monitoring, can be implemented to protect your website and sensitive data. You have full control over security configurations, reducing the risk of vulnerabilities.
- Linux Windows Shared Hosting: Security measures are managed by the hosting provider, with limited control over server-level security settings. While providers implement security protocols, the shared nature of hosting can expose websites to potential security risks from neighboring sites.
Conclusion
In conclusion, Linux Dedicated Hosting offers superior performance, reliability, and security for websites or applications that require dedicated resources, high performance levels, and customizable server configurations. It is ideal for businesses with specific performance requirements, e-commerce platforms, or websites with high traffic volumes.
Linux Windows Shared Hosting, while more cost-effective and user-friendly, provides shared resources and limited customization compared to dedicated hosting. It suits smaller websites, blogs, or startups with moderate traffic and basic hosting needs, where performance fluctuations and shared security risks are acceptable.
When deciding between Linux dedicated hosting and Linux Windows shared hosting, consider your website’s performance requirements, scalability needs, budget constraints, and the level of control and security you require. Both hosting types offer distinct advantages based on your priorities and business goals, ensuring that you can provide a seamless and reliable online experience for your visitors.